Licensed Log Scaler,Adams Lake, British Columbia Interfor is seeking energetic and enthusiastic team players to join our team as a full-timeLicensed Log ScalerinChase. Starting rate for this position is $39.20per hour. Applicants should live in or be willing to relocate to the Chase/Shuswap Lakes area. This is NOT a camp or remote work facility. What You''ll Do Scale and grade logs in accordance with BC Interior Scaling Manual Assess logs in accordance with company quality specs Assess log lengths and mark for bucking Conduct weighmaster duties as required Use Ministry-approved software and handheld data-loggers Maintain scale sites and infrastructure Enter accurate data and maintain quality control Adhere to safety and team collaboration standards Available to work 8-10 hour shifts Be willing to train on equipment such as wheel loader and log dump/tower What You Offer Valid BC driver''s license Valid Interior BC Log Scaling License Prior log scaling or forestry experience (1+ year preferred) Physically fit and able to be outside for extended periods of time (in all seasons)measuring and assessing logs. Technologically literate (comfortable with devices and software) Strong numeracy, attention to detail, and calm under pressure Team player with strong interpersonal skills Previous experience operating heavy equipment and a mechanical aptitude would be an asset Who We Are Interfor is a growth-oriented forest products company, operating in all major forest products markets across North America. Check out our Employee Development Programs to learn more at Life in Adams Lake Located in southern British Columbia, Adams Lake is surrounded by forest-covered mountainsides making it an ideal location for outdoor adventurers who enjoy snowmobiling, snowshoeing, hiking, off-roading, fishing, kayaking, hunting, water sports, camping, and more. Nestled by the western gateway of the spectacular Shuswap Lake system, Adams Lake is located approximately 25km from Chase, a vibrant and progressive community of approximately 2,600 residents. Chase is located 58km east of Kamloops (pop. 103,150), 45km west of Salmon Arm (pop. 20,100), and 19km west of Sorrento (pop. 6,500).
